Transaction

1cfcef079fcaa2646503e7a95a2ff83cc4df235320dbef84028fb03d2dbfaca4
304,690 confirmations
Timestamp
1589077964
Block629,720
Fee29,776 sats
Fee rate2 sats/vB
view on mempool.space

Inputs & Outputs

Inputs